Sophie Marceau in With Love... from the Age of Reason (2010)

Trivia

With Love... from the Age of Reason

Edit
Marguerite has images of noted female figures in her desk and she uses them as role models in her business dealings. Most are well-known e.g. Coco Chanel, Ava Gardner, Joan of Arc, Marie Curie (Marie Curie). One name - Denise Fabre - will be unfamiliar to non-French audiences. Denise Fabre is a noted French radio and television presenter, and has hosted the Eurovision Song Contest. She has also worked as a journalist.
Maitre Mérignac is seen pruning a rose bush he calls 'Rosa gallica'. He makes the comment that the variety is the ancestor of all roses. 'Rosa gallica' is recognized as one of earliest cultivars of the rose family, known to ancient Greeks and Romans as well as mediaeval gardeners. It is believed that most modern European roses have some trace of Rosa gallica in their ancestry.
Philibert and Marguerite meet at the 'Angel Cave'. There are no major caves nor grottoes near Saou, nor is there a cave system called 'Angel Cave' or 'Angel Grotto' in France. The nearest cave/ grotto to Saou which matches the appearance of the one in the film is 'Grotte de Choranche', which lies to the north.
